Wastewater discharge into Storm Lake Monday night

STORM LAKE – Officials in the city of Storm Lake reported to DNR this morning that an unknown, but small, amount of untreated wastewater leaked into Storm Lake overnight.

The discharge occurred through a leaking valve after the city closed a pumping station on the west side of the lake Monday.

When discovered Tuesday morning, the city immediately pumped out wastewater in the pumping station, worked on the valves and stopped the wastewater flow. City officials plan to fill the area with concrete today to prevent future leaks.

The DNR cautions people to keep children and pets away from the inlet from Little Storm into Storm Lake for the next 24 hours.
